There are two types of electric guitar pickups: single coils and humbuckers. Single coil pickups came first. A single coil is just a single spool containing one or more magnets. The single coil pickup will typically have a more treble sound.

Humbuckers, were created by a Gibson employee back in the 1950's. Humbuckers are two single coil pickups that are wired together. By wiring a pair of single coil pickups together, they pick up less noise than a single coil pickup, and you get richer, fatter tone. The humbuckers were created to reject (buck) interference (hum) but allow the signal from the guitar strings to get through.

Humbuckers also create more output than single coil pickups, so they overdrive amps differently. There are also stacked humbuckers which are the same as side by side humbuckers, but they fit into a single coil slot.
